Professional Course Admission in Kerala

“Government cannot scrap the current system altogether”

Thiruvananthapuram: The Kerala Government proposes to overhaul the present system of admission to professional course scientifically, Parliamentary Affairs Minister M.Vijayakumar told the Assembly on Tuesday.

Responding to the calling attention motion by A.P. Anil Kumar (Congress), the Minister said the Government had already constituted a committee headed by the Higher Education Secretary to go into the issue, The Government would initiates action in the matter on receipt of the committee’s report, he added. Mr. Vijayakumar pointed out that the State had gone in for the single window admission system following detection of serious irregularities in the qualifying examinations way back in 1980 and the growing popularity of courses conducted by different boards which gave marks to their students based on divergent criteria.
